"48 HOURS: THE ULTIMATUM" IS SATURDAY'S #1 PROGRAM WITH ADULTS 25-54 AND VIEWERS

"48 Hours" Posts Double-Digit Year-to-Year Percentage Increases From Last Year

48 HOURS: "The Ultimatum" was Saturday's #1 program with adults 25-54, the demographic that matters most to those who advertise in news, and viewers, according to Nielsen live plus same day ratings for August 8.

48 HOURS: "The Ultimatum" (R) was also #1 at 10:00 PM with adults 25-54, viewers and adults 18-49. The broadcast delivered 4.99 million viewers, a 1.2/04 with adults 25-54 and a 0.8/03 with adults 18-49. Compared to the same night last year, 48 HOURS was up +20% in adults 25-54, +38% in viewers and +33% in adults 18-49.

"The Ultimatum" was the second part of a 48 HOURS double feature that began at 9:00 PM with an encore of "The Lost Daughter," which was #1 at with viewers (4.47m), adults 25-54 (1.0/04) and adults 18-49 (0.7/03). "The Lost Daughter" was the night's #2 program with viewers, behind "The Ultimatum."

"The Ultimatum" featured Peter Van Sant and 48 HOURS' investigation into the murder of Vanessa Mintz, a mother, wife and businesswoman who was gunned down in a family-owned mountain lodge in North Carolina. The investigation into what happened to Mintz would expose a hidden secret and her two daughters, Jessica Freeman and Andrea Little Gray, would emerge as powerful advocates for their mother.

"The Lost Daughter" featured Tracy Smith and 48 HOURS' investigation into the search for Tiffany Sessions, a Florida college student who went out for a walk in 1989 and never returned. The disappearance launched a massive search driven by her father, marketing executive Pat Sessions. Members of the Alachua County Sheriff's Office have not given up, and believe they have a link to the disappearance. The 48 HOURS team has been reporting on Sessions' disappearance for more than six years, and was there when members of the Alachua County Sheriff's Office excavated the trees and underbrush where another student was found dead 22 years earlier. Police believe the same site was a serial killer's burial ground.
